DIRECTIONS

Image Step 01
01 Step

Recipe View In a shallow glass bowl, whisk together the soy sauce, dark soy sauce, sesame oil, oyster sauce, garlic powder, onion powder, ground black pepper, and dried basil. (Prep time: 5 minutes)

Image Step 02
02 Step

Recipe View Add the chicken wings to the marinade, ensuring they are fully coated. Cover the bowl tightly with plastic wrap and refrigerate for at least 8 hours, or preferably overnight, to allow the flavors to fully penetrate the chicken. (Marinating time: 8+ hours)

Image Step 03
03 Step

Recipe View The next day, give the wings a good stir to redistribute the marinade. (Prep time: 2 minutes)

Image Step 04
04 Step

Recipe View Lightly oil the grill grates to prevent sticking and preheat your grill to high heat. (Prep time: 5 minutes)

Image Step 05
05 Step

Recipe View Remove the chicken wings from the marinade, discarding any remaining marinade. Grill the chicken wings over the preheated grill for 8 to 12 minutes per side, or until they are cooked through and the juices run clear when pierced with a fork. (Grilling time: 16-24 minutes)

Image Step 06
06 Step

Recipe View Remove from the grill and let rest for 5 minutes before serving. This allows the juices to redistribute, resulting in more tender and flavorful wings.

For an extra smoky flavor, consider using a charcoal grill with wood chips, such as hickory or mesquite.
If you don't have dried basil, you can substitute with 2 tablespoons of fresh basil, finely chopped.
Adjust the amount of black pepper according to your preference.
For spicier wings, add a pinch of cayenne pepper or a dash of your favorite chili sauce to the marinade.
